Unleash Your Inner Vampire: A Guide to the Vampiro Cocktail

Wed, Mar 27, 24  |  tequila cocktails

The Vampiro ("Vampire" in Spanish) is a bold and flavorful Mexican cocktail that combines the smoky heat of tequila with the tangy sweetness of tomato and citrus juices.  This spicy and refreshing drink is perfect for those who enjoy a bit of an adventurous sip.

There are two main variations of the Vampiro: the classic layered version and the stirred version.  Both offer a delicious take on this unique cocktail.

Ingredients (Classic Layered Vampiro):

  • 1 ounce Silver Tequila (100% agave recommended)
  • 1 ounce Fresh Lime Juice
  • 4 ounces Sangrita (tomato-based, citrusy Mexican beverage)
  • 2-4 ounces Squirt (grapefruit soda) or other citrus soda to taste
  • Tajin Seasoning (chili-lime seasoning blend) - for rimming the glass (optional)
  • Lime Wedge (for garnish)

Instructions (Classic Layered Vampiro):

Prep the glass (optional): If using Tajin seasoning, place a shallow layer on a small plate. Rub a lime wedge around the rim of a highball or rocks glass, then dip the rim in the Tajin seasoning to create a spicy rim.

Build the layers: Add ice to the prepared glass. Pour the tequila and lime juice into the glass. Slowly pour the sangrita over the back of a spoon to create a separate layer. Finally, gently top the drink with Squirt, allowing it to float on top.

Garnish: Add a lime wedge for garnish.

Ingredients (Stirred Vampiro):

  • 2 ounces Silver Tequila (100% agave recommended)
  • 1 ounce Fresh Lime Juice
  • 3 ounces Sangrita
  • ½ teaspoon Sriracha Sauce (or to taste)
  • Pinch of Salt
  • Pinch of Black Pepper
  • Lime Wedge (for garnish)

Instructions (Stirred Vampiro):

  1. Combine the ingredients: In a shaker filled with ice, add the tequila, lime juice, sangrita, sriracha, salt, and pepper. Shake well for about 15 seconds.

  2. Strain and serve: Strain the cocktail into a chilled rocks glass filled with fresh ice.

  3. Garnish: Add a lime wedge for garnish.

Tips:

  • Sangrita Variations: Sangrita can be homemade or store-bought. If making your own, there are many recipes available online. The key ingredients are tomato juice, orange juice, lime juice, chilies, and spices.

  • Spice it Up: Adjust the amount of sriracha to your desired level of spiciness.

  • Citrus Swap: If you don't have Squirt, you can substitute another citrus soda like grapefruit soda or orange soda.

  • On the Rocks or Up: The Vampiro can be served on the rocks (with ice) or up (without ice).
